Web24 mrt. 2024 · Get 30 minutes of aerobic exercise a day to improve bone health. Regular aerobic exercise will help you increase and maintain your bone density while also improving your overall health. Try to get at least half an hour of exercise each day to keep your bones healthy and to minimize bone loss. Web7 apr. 2024 · Osteopenia is a condition caused by less than average bone mass, but not to the point that the bone can be easily fractured. It is similar to osteoporosis in that it affects bone mineral density. Osteopenia is less severe than osteoporosis but should be taken seriously since it can progress to osteoporosis.
